The Desert Flower Foundation on Tuesday July 23rd 2019 completed its quarterly financial support to some deprived Sierra Leonean school-going children in their kindergarten stage until they have attained or completed university education.

The quarterly financial support which was described by many as a timely gesture targeted deprived communities nationwide such as Allen Town, Dwerzark, Central Freetown in the Western Urban District, Western Area; Bo, Bo District, Southern Region; Kaffu Bullom, Port Loko District, North-west Region; Koya, Western Rural District, Western Area; and Magburaka, Tonkonlili District, Northern Region of Sierra Leone, respectively.

 

The quarterly financial support is targeting some 1,000 school -going girls and their Mothers in various parts of Sierra Leone. For a girl to benefit from the Foundation’s educational scholarship and other financial support, she must not enter into marital relationship or mutilated until she finishes her secondary and tertiary education.

The Project Supervisor, Wuyatta Genda said the project would give more support to better shape the mindset of girls who started from nursery to the age of consent as they would all focus on how to better educate themselves. She advised parents to always monitor their children, as they would frown at anyone who goes outside the principles and philosophy of the Desert Flower Foundation.

Wuyatta Genda described education as an essential tool for the girl-child. She said with education the sky would be their limit in achieving their dreams.

She disclosed that they also provide the girls with counseling during the entire duration of their participation in the Project.

She maintained that there is a very cordial relationship between the Project and the mothers of the children and that they have been very cooperative in honoring the contractual agreement.

There was huge turnout from families and beneficiaries during the payment periods in all locations nationwide. The Payment of Sponsorship funds was welcomed with great anxiety and happiness by parents (beneficiaries) of Desert Flower Foundation who were eagerly waiting for staff of the charitable organization.

Parents thanked Desert Flower Foundation for their continued support and asked that the project be replicated in areas that are not yet benefiting from Desert Flower Foundation project where there are many young girls.

The Founder of Desert Flower Foundation is International Super Model, Actress and Author Waris Dirie. Support for the girls is being done under the Foundation’s Save a Little Flower Project. Dirie is a fierce Activist against FGM, having herself had gone through difficulties growing up in her native Somalia. The Desert Flower Foundation was named after a movie depicting her life and her rise to global stardom. She was one time UN Special Ambassador against Harmful Traditional Practices.
